Yes. Microsoft Corp. pays a dividend. Note that perpetual contracts on MSFT do not pay dividends; only holders of the underlying shares receive them.

MSFT's price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io is 23.17. The P/E ratio compares share price to earnings per share, giving a quick proxy for how richly the shares are priced relative to profitability.
